What is the pressure of nitrogen in atmospheres of a sample that is at 745 mmHg?

The correct answer is 0.9803 atm

Given, pressure of nitrogen =  745 mmHg

Conversion factor: 760 mmHg = 1 atm

Converting 745 mmHg to 1 atm

745 mmHg x ( 1 atm / 760 mmHg) = 0.9803 atm

So is the pressure of nitrogen is  0.9803 atm
